admin 管理员组

文章数量: 1086019


2024年6月6日发(作者:好看的表格图片)

linu中简述文件、文件夹、文件系统三者的

关系

文件、文件夹和文件系统是计算机存储和组织数据的重要概念,

它们之间具有密切的关联。在Linux操作系统中,文件和文件夹是基

本的存储单位,而文件系统则是用于管理和组织文件和文件夹的机制。

文件是存储在计算机系统中的一系列数据。它可以是文本文件、

图像文件、音频文件、视频文件等。文件以二进制的形式存储在存储

设备中,可以通过文件路径来访问和操作。文件由文件名和文件扩展

名组成,用于标识文件的类型和内容。例如,""是一个文

本文件,扩展名为".txt"。

文件夹是用于组织和存储文件的容器。它可以包含其他文件夹和

文件。文件夹可以嵌套,形成一个文件和文件夹的层次结构。文件夹

通过路径进行标识,路径是一系列文件夹的名称,用斜杠"/"分隔。例

如,"/home/user/documents"是一个文件夹路径,表示根文件夹下的

"user"文件夹中的"documents"文件夹。

文件系统是操作系统用于管理和组织存储设备上的文件和文件夹

的机制。它定义了文件和文件夹在存储设备上的存储方式和访问方式。

Linux中常见的文件系统有ext4、NTFS和FAT等。文件系统通过将文

件和文件夹分配给磁盘块或扇区来存储数据,并使用文件系统表来记

录文件和文件夹的元数据(如大小、权限和创建日期等)和位置信息。

文件、文件夹和文件系统之间的关系较为复杂,可以总结为以下

几点:

1、文件属于文件夹。文件通过路径来描述其位置,路径中包含了

文件所在的文件夹结构。文件夹可以在其中创建、删除和移动文件。

例如,可以通过在文件夹中创建一个新的文本文件来在文件夹中存储

数据。

2、文件夹属于文件系统。文件夹是文件系统中的一种特殊类型的

文件。文件系统将文件夹与其他文件和文件夹分开,以便于管理和组

织。文件夹可以在文件系统中创建、删除和移动。

3、文件系统管理文件和文件夹。文件系统负责将文件和文件夹存

储在存储设备(如硬盘、固态硬盘等)中,并提供文件和文件夹的访

问功能。它可以在存储设备上分配空间来存储文件的数据,并维护文

件的元数据和位置信息。

4、文件系统通过文件路径来定位文件和文件夹。文件路径描述了

文件和文件夹在文件系统中的位置。文件路径可以是绝对路径或相对

路径。绝对路径从根文件夹开始,指定完整的路径结构,而相对路径

是相对于当前文件夹的路径。

5、文件系统提供了对文件和文件夹的操作和管理功能。它可以创

建、删除、复制和移动文件和文件夹。文件系统还管理文件和文件夹

的权限和属性,确保只有授权的用户才能访问和修改文件和文件夹。

在Linux系统中,文件和文件夹是基本的存储单位,文件系统是

对它们进行管理和组织的机制。文件系统通过路径来定位文件和文件

夹,提供了丰富的操作和管理功能。文件和文件夹的关系是通过路径

和位置信息来建立的,在文件系统中相互关联并协同工作,实现了数

据的有效存储和组织。


本文标签: 文件 文件夹 路径 组织 数据